Sanitation Dept.: Collection service schedule is ongoing
The New York City Sanitation Department released a statement Wednesday saying its collection services are ongoing amid the coronavirus pandemic.

The department advised New York City residents to follow their normal collection schedule.

Residents should put items curbside between 4 p.m. to midnight the evening before pickup day.

The department says services that are currently suspended are food scrap drop-off and apartment and curbside e-waste.
